Suggestion on tires? and wheels?
I've been debating on what size rim I should get and tires to put onto it.
I really like the work emotion cr but I don't have the cash to do that :x So I figured I would just go rota torque.. (i'd get it from our sponsor if he had gunmetal for those "pimp" rims he's selling) But I'm debating on size... 15x6.5 or 17x7.5? and what size tires should I use? |

Stick with the 15" rim size from factory. You can get rims lighter then the stock rims in 15". This will help with fuel economy as well as acceleration. The rota torques are nice looking wheels :)
I myself am waiting to see if I can get the SSR Competitions in 15"(they weigh 8lbs)
